The only way I can think of would be to write your own PrintStream
implementation which created a stack trace when the println
method was called, in order to work out the class name. It would be pretty horrible, but it should work... proof of concept sample code:
import java.io.*;
class TracingPrintStream extends PrintStream {
public TracingPrintStream(PrintStream original) {
super(original);
}
// You'd want to override other methods too, of course.
@Override
public void println(String line) {
StackTraceElement[] stack = Thread.currentThread().getStackTrace();
// Element 0 is getStackTrace
// Element 1 is println
// Element 2 is the caller
StackTraceElement caller = stack[2];
super.println(caller.getClassName() + ": " + line);
}
}
public class Test {
public static void main(String[] args) throws Exception {
System.setOut(new TracingPrintStream(System.out));
System.out.println("Sample line");
}
}
(In your code you would make it log to log4j instead of course... or possibly as well.)
